Rumah > pangkalan data > tutorial mysql > CentOS6 安装 MySQL 并配置_MySQL

CentOS6 安装 MySQL 并配置_MySQL

W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B
Lepaskan: 2016-06-01 13:11:26
asal
1784 orang telah melayarinya

CentOS6CentOS

CentOS6 修改 MySQL 配置

查看系统是否安装了MySQL -->使用命令:

rpm -qa | grep mysql 
Salin selepas log masuk

卸载已安装的MySQL-->使用命令:

#rpm -e --nodeps  mysql-libs-5.1.61-4.el6.x86_64要将 /var/lib/mysql文件夹下的所有文件都删除干净
Salin selepas log masuk

MySQ安装

1. 执行命令:安装mysql-server

yum -y install mysql-server
Salin selepas log masuk
2. 安装完成后执行初始化命令
service mysqld start  或  /etc/init.d/mysqld start
Salin selepas log masuk
3. 修改mysql的配置文件(修改默认编码)

复制my-large.cnf文件到/etc/my.cnf --> 执行命令:

cp /usr/share/doc/mysql-server-4.1.12/my-large.cnf  /etc/my.cnf如果提示是否覆盖,Y 即可;
Salin selepas log masuk

打开my.cnf修改编码 --> 执行命令:

vim /etc/my.cnf在[mysqld]下添加:default-character-set=utf8修改指定的默认的引擎:default-storage-engine=INNODB是否区分大小写:  lower_case_table_names=1  0:区分大小写 1:不区分大小写<p>在[client]下添加:default-character-set=utf8</p>
Salin selepas log masuk
4. 重启MySQL服务 --> 执行命令:
service mysqld restart   或 /etc/init.d/mysqld restart
Salin selepas log masuk
5. 登陆mysql --> 执行命令:
mysql  或 mysql -uroot -p查看 mysql的编码show variables like 'character%'; 显示:+--------------------------+----------------------------+| Variable_name            | Value                      |+--------------------------+----------------------------+| character_set_client     | utf8                       || character_set_connection | utf8                       || character_set_database   | utf8                       || character_set_filesystem | binary                     || character_set_results    | utf8                       || character_set_server     | utf8                       || character_set_system     | utf8                       || character_sets_dir       | /usr/share/mysql/charsets/ |+--------------------------+----------------------------+修改成功;
Salin selepas log masuk

为连接MySQL的主机分配权限(方便远程连接MySQL数据库):

mysql> GRANT ALL ON *.* TO 'username'@'%' identified by 'password' WITH GRANT OPTION; //%可以是你的IP 注意:修改在防火墙 开启 3306 端口;在本人博客:http://my.oschina.net/haopeng/blog/268523
Salin selepas log masuk

安装完成之后为MySQL设置root密码--> 使用命令:

/usr/bin/mysqladmin -u root password '123456'
Salin selepas log masuk

修改mysql root 密码

SET PASSWORD FOR 'root'@'localhost' = PASSWORD('newpass');
Salin selepas log masuk

mysql安装目录说明

/var/lib/mysql           数据库文件/usr/share/mysql         命令及配置文件/usr/bin                 (mysqladmin、mysqldump等命令)
Salin selepas log masuk



 



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an